According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 27 reports of Circulatory collapse have been filed in association with GLYBURIDE (Glyburide). This represents 1.3% of all adverse event reports for GLYBURIDE.

How Dangerous Is Circulatory collapse From GLYBURIDE?
Of the 27 reports, 11 (40.7%) resulted in death, 4 (14.8%) required hospitalization, and 14 (51.9%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Circulatory collapse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for GLYBURIDE. However, 27 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
